Sikkim, a small state in the northeastern part of India, is renowned for its natural beauty and diverse geography. The state is characterized by its mountainous terrain, dense forests, and a variety of water bodies, including rivers, streams, and lakes. Among these water bodies, the natural lakes of Sikkim hold a special place due to their ecological significance and scenic beauty.

The number of natural lakes in Sikkim is a key geographical fact that reflects the state's rich biodiversity and natural resources. According to geographical records and studies, Sikkim has 7 natural lakes. These lakes are not only important for their ecological value but also for their contribution to the state's tourism industry. Each of these lakes has its own unique features and is often a destination for both domestic and international tourists.

The lakes in Sikkim are typically located in high-altitude areas, which means they are often surrounded by snow-capped mountains and dense forests. This setting makes them ideal for various recreational activities such as trekking, camping, and photography. Additionally, these lakes play a crucial role in the local ecosystem by providing habitats for various species of flora and fauna.

It is important to note that the number of lakes in Sikkim is not to be confused with other water bodies such as rivers, streams, or artificial lakes. The 7 natural lakes are specifically recognized for their natural formation and ecological importance. Some of the well-known natural lakes in Sikkim include Khecheopalri Lake, Tsomgo Lake, and Gurudongmar Lake, each with its own unique characteristics and significance.
